EnviroWay Detergent Manufacturing Inc., a proudly Saskatchewan-based manufacturer of green cleaning solutions, is seeking a dynamic, smart, and proactive Data Entry Operator role at our office in Regina, Saskatchewan.


About the Role

The Data Entry Operator will be tasked with input of paper-based information into our digital systems. The company will rely on this job holder to have accurate and updated data that are easily accessible through a digital database.


Job Responsibilities

  • Ensuring appropriate turnaround time on all data entry
  • Reviewing and entering data information like invoices, records, inventory into the appropriate databases
  • Proactively verifying data through source documents for accuracy and completeness of data
  • Monitoring and updating existing data when required
  • Retrieving data for team members upon request
  • Performing data searches
  • Identify, label and organize electronic storage media
  • Maintain libraries of electronic storage media
  • Complying with security backups and regular checkups to ensure the safety of the data being stored.

Desired Qualifications

  • Minimum of 2+ years' experience of working on a Data Entry position
  • IT-savvy and basic knowledge of touch-typing system
  • Basic knowledge of database management tools
  • Fast typing skills with close attention to detail
  • Good communication skill both oral and writing.
  • Great understanding of data and confidentiality principles are compulsory.
